Yes, you can obtain flight records. For commercial flights, contact the airline directly or visit their website. They can provide details about past flights. For private flights, you might need to contact the aircraft's operator or the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) if in the U.S. Remember, accessibility might vary based on the country's regulations and the information you are entitled to.

  1. How can I request my commercial flight records? You can request your commercial flight records by contacting the airline directly through their customer service or checking their website for flight history options.
  2. Are private flight records publicly accessible? Private flight records are generally less accessible and often require contacting the aircraft operator or the FAA, depending on the country’s regulations.
  3. What information is needed to obtain flight records from the FAA? Typically, you need details such as the aircraft tail number, flight date, and operator information when requesting flight records from the FAA.
